Farm Green Super Market, Kozhikode



Fresh Vegetables and fruits, Farm Green and other groceries.

Address:
Farm Green Super Market
V Panoli Road
Thiruthiyad
Kozhikode, Kerala 673004
India

Phone: 0495 405 4222

Web : https://farm-green-supermarket.business.site/